What is the equation for speed?
Speed = distance / time
What is speed the symbol equation?
v = s/t
What is speed an example of?
A scalar quantity
Why is speed a scalar quantity?
Speed is a scalar quantity because it doesn’t involve direction.
What is the normal walking speed?
1.5 m/s
What is the normal running speed?
3 m/s
What is the normal cycling speed?
6 m/s
What is the normal speed of a car on a main road?
13 m/s
What is the normal speed of a fast train in UK?
50 m/s
What is the normal speed for a cruising aeroplane?
250 m/s
What is the normal speed of sound in air?
330 m/s
What does distance travelled equal to?
Distance = speed x time
What is velocity?
The velocity of an object is its speed in a given direction.
What is velocity an example of?
Vector quantity
What is velocity in terms of a circle?
If an object moves at a constant speed in a CIRCLE then its velocity is constantly changing even though its speed is constant.
What does the special rule of velocity and moving around a circle also apply to?
This also includes an object moving around part of a circle, like moving around a corner

What does the gradient of a distance time graph tell us?
The gradient tells us the objects speed.
What does an upward sloping curve show us in a distance time graph?
This tells us that the object is constantly increasing in speed.
ACCELERATING
What does the acceleration of an object tell us?
The acceleration tells us the change in its velocity over a given time.
What is the equation for acceleration?
Acceleration = change in velocity / time
How do calculate change in velocity?
(Final velocity - initial velocity)
What does a negative number mean in terms of velocity?
Decelerating
